Join AIGA Boston and Lesley University for a discussion on Vaughan Oliver’s work, followed by a dialogue among the panelists and audience. This is in conjunction with an exhibition Walking Backwards, showcasing Oliver’s work in the Roberts and Raizes galleries, Lesley University College of Art and Design.
Panelists include Clif Stoltze, Timothy Samara, Kenneth Fitzgerald, Timothy O'Donnell. Moderated by Kristina Lamour Sansone.
